OHSA Opens Investigation Into 52-Year-Old Construction Worker’s Death 

Article Featured Image

Malta’s Operational Health and Safety Authority has opened up an investigation into the tragic death of a 52-year-old construction worker in Qormi. 

An investigation was opened immediately after the incident. However, OHSA is not in a position to make further comments pending investigation. 

The worker, a Georgian national who lives in St Paul’s Bay, fell three storeys from a construction site he was working on. He died a few hours later after being rushed to the hospital.

The construction industry is one of the deadliest in Malta with countless fatalities and injuries reported throughout the year. Still, safety remains an issue with videos of unsafe construction sites regularly flooding social media feeds.
